WebApr 12, 2024 · Russia — 6,601,668 Square Miles (17,098,242 Square Kilometers) Russia is the largest country in the world by a long shot. More than twice as big as Brazil (the 5th largest country in the world). Russia accounts for one-tenth of the world's landmass, occupies two different continents, spans 11 time zones and borders 14 other countries. Comparing Fractions Calculator
WebThis is a lot faster than working out the lowest common denominator. All we do here is divide the numerator by the denominator for each fraction: 1/4 = 0.25. 5/8 = 0.625. Now that these fractions have been converted to decimal format, we can compare the numbers to get our answer. 0.25 is NOT greater than 0.625 which also means that 1/4 is NOT ...
